A Fancy Party Celebrating Y as Long E!

Who doesn't love a party? The big talk in first grade is always about going to friends' birthday parties! Well last year I decided to throw a party in honor of Fancy Y!


Didn't you know that Y becomes a fancy letter when it sounds like e at the end of a two syllable word?! 

Of course, no party can begin without a formal invitation! So before I taught the y spelling pattern for long e I sent out a formal invitation to each of my kiddos:


 This built up so much excitement for fancy y! Even my boys got into it! I cannot tell you how CUTE the kids were when they arrived all decked out in fancy clothes. One of my girls wore her old flower girl dress and I even had boys in ties and one come in a suit (his mom said that he begged to wear it!)

To start our fancy party, I began by reading Fancy Nancy. I told the kids that it was Fancy Y's favorite book, so we read it looking for fancy y words.

 I also gathered other Fancy Nancy books to keep in our library for the week for the students to read:

We did lots of fun and fancy activities to celebrate Fancy Y: a tasty pastry room hunt, a starry class game to identify fancy words, and we even made a classy book of fancy words!
My kids LOVED adding to our classy book! I put it in our classroom library so that they could enjoy reading it.
